1C proqramlaşdırmada peşəkar yanaşma – biznesiniz üçün optimal həllər

Qalereya

Əlaqə

+994-10-101-31-41

Zahid Xəlilov küç. 1A

info@kodyaz.az

01

# 1C:Müəssisə 8.3: Effektiv İstifadəçi İnterfeysi və Alt Sistemlərin İdarəsi (Подсистемы)

1C:Müəssisə 8.3-də Tətbiqin Effektiv İstifadəçi İnterfeysinin Təşkili: Alt Sistemlər və Onların İdarə Edilməsi

02

1C:Müəssisə platforması, müxtəlif biznes sahələrində avtomatlaşdırma imkanları ilə geniş yayılmışdır. Bu platformanın güclü cəhətlərindən biri də tətbiq həllərinin istifadəçi interfeysini çevik şəkildə konfiqurasiya etmək bacarığıdır. Düzgün təşkil edilmiş istifadəçi interfeysi (UI) sistemlə işləməyin səmərəliliyini artırır, naviqasiyanı asanlaşdırır və müxtəlif istifadəçi kateqoriyaları (məsələn, menecerlər, mühasiblər, anbar işçiləri) üçün yalnız onlara aid olan funksionallığın görünməsini təmin edir. 1C:Müəssisə 8.3-də bu məqsədlə əsas vasitələrdən biri “Alt Sistemlər” (Подсистемы) adlanan konfiqurasiya obyektləridir.

Alt Sistemlər Nədir və Niyə Vacibdir?

Alt sistemlər, 1C:Müəssisə tətbiqinin interfeysini məntiqi hissələrə bölmək üçün istifadə olunan əsas konfiqurasiya elementləridir. Onlar eyni tematik qrupa aid olan konfiqurasiya obyektlərini (soraqçalar, sənədlər, hesabatlar və s.) birləşdirməyə imkan verir. Məsələn, bir təşkilatda satış əməliyyatları ilə bağlı bütün sənədlər və hesabatlar “Satış” alt sistemində, daxilolmalarla bağlı olanlar isə “Daxilolma” alt sistemində qruplaşdırıla bilər.

Alt sistemlərdən istifadə etməyin bir neçə əsas üstünlüyü var:

  • Naviqasiyanın Asanlaşdırılması: Alt sistemlər, istifadəçilərin böyük həcmli funksionallıq arasında asanlıqla naviqasiya etməsinə kömək edən aydın və strukturlaşdırılmış menyu yaradır.
  • Fərqli İstifadəçi Rolları üçün Fərdiləşdirmə: Hər bir alt sistemi müəyyən istifadəçi rollarına bağlamaq mümkündür. Bu o deməkdir ki, müəyyən bir vəzifədə işləyən istifadəçi yalnız öz işi üçün zəruri olan alt sistemləri və onlara daxil olan obyektləri görəcək. Bu, interfeysi təmizləyir və istifadəçilərin diqqətini vacib tapşırıqlara yönəldir.
  • Modulluq və Genişlənmə Qabiliyyəti: Alt sistemlər tətbiqin modul olmasını təmin edir. Gələcəkdə yeni funksionallıq əlavə etmək və ya mövcud olanları dəyişdirmək, tətbiqin ümumi strukturuna təsir etmədən müəyyən alt sistemlər daxilində asanlıqla həyata keçirilə bilər.
  • İnformasiya Bazasının Strukturlu Saxlanması: Alt sistemlər konfiqurasiya obyektlərini məntiqi qruplaşdırmağa kömək edir, bu da inkişaf prosesini və gələcəkdə tətbiqin saxlanmasını asanlaşdırır.

Alt Sistemlərin Yaradılmasına Praktiki Yanaşma

1C:Müəssisə 8.3 konfiquratorunda yeni alt sistemlərin yaradılması sadə və intuitiv bir prosesdir. Tutaq ki, biz təşkilatımızın işini idarə etmək üçün “İdarəetmə”, malların daxilolmasını izləmək üçün “Daxilolma” və satış əməliyyatlarını qeyd etmək üçün “Satış” adlı üç əsas alt sistem yaratmaq istəyirik.

Adətən, konfiqurasiya prosesi “Konfiqurasiya” pəncərəsində başlayır. Bu pəncərə, tətbiqin bütün konfiqurasiya obyektlərini ağacvari strukturda əks etdirir.

  1. “Ümumi” (Общие) Budağını Genişləndirmək: Konfiqurasiya ağacında “Ümumi” budağını tapın və üzərinə “plus” işarəsinə klikləyərək genişləndirin. Burada “Alt Sistemlər” (Подсистемы) qovluğunu görəcəksiniz.
  2. Yeni Alt Sistem Əlavə Etmək: “Alt Sistemlər” qovluğunun üzərində sağ klikləyin və açılan kontekst menyusundan “Əlavə et” (Добавить) seçimini edin. Bu, “Konfiqurasiya obyektini redaktə etmə pəncərəsi”ni açacaq.
  3. Alt Sistemin Adını Müəyyənləşdirmək: Açılan pəncərədə “Əsas” (Основные) vərəqəsində “Ad” (Имя) sahəsinə alt sistemin adını daxil edin. Məsələn, ilk alt sistem üçün “İdarəetmə” (Управление) yazın. “Sinonim” (Синоним) sahəsi avtomatik olaraq doldurulacaq və ya siz onu istifadəçi üçün daha aydın bir adla əvəz edə bilərsiniz (məsələn, “İdarəetmə Paneli”). “Şərh” (Комментарий) sahəsini isə alt sistemin təsviri üçün istifadə edə bilərsiniz.
  4. Əlavə Alt Sistemlərin Yaradılması: Yuxarıdakı addımları təkrarlayaraq “Daxilolma” (Поступление) və “Satış” (Продажа) alt sistemlərini yaradın. Hər biri üçün müvafiq adları daxil edin.

Bu addımları tamamladıqdan sonra, konfiqurasiya ağacında “Alt Sistemlər” budağı altında üç yeni element görünəcək. Hələlik bu alt sistemlər boşdur, yəni onlara hər hansı bir soraqça, sənəd və ya hesabat daxil edilməyib.

Tətbiqin Bölmələr Paneli və Alt Sistemlər

Alt sistemlərin konfiqurator rejimində yaradılması başa çatdıqdan sonra, “1C:Müəssisə” istifadəçi rejiminə keçərək nəticəni yoxlamaq lazımdır. Bunun üçün konfiqurator menyusundan “Sazlama” (Отладка) -> “Sazlamaya Başla” (Начать отладку) seçin.

Tətbiqin əsas pəncərəsi açıldıqda, yuxarıda, əsas menyunun altında “Bölmələr Paneli” (Панель разделов приложения) görünəcək. Yeni yaratdığımız “İdarəetmə”, “Daxilolma”“Satış” alt sistemləri bu paneldə ayrı-ayrı bölmələr kimi əks olunacaq. Hələlik, bu bölmələrə kliklədikdə heç bir funksionallıq açılmayacaq, çünki onlara hər hansı bir konfiqurasiya obyekti təyin etməmişik.

Bu paneldə “Əsas” (Главное) adlı bir bölmə də avtomatik olaraq yaradılır. Bu bölmə, istifadəçilər tərəfindən ən çox istifadə edilən əmrlərin və obyektlərin yerləşdirilməsi üçün nəzərdə tutulmuşdur. Gələcəkdə, biz soraqçalar, sənədlər və hesabatlar kimi digər konfiqurasiya obyektlərini yaratdıqca, onları müvafiq alt sistemlərə bağlayacağıq və onlar tətbiqin interfeysində görünməyə başlayacaq.

Alt Sistemlərə Obyektlərin Təyin Edilməsi

Alt sistemlər yaradıldıqdan sonra, növbəti mərhələ onlara soraqçalar, sənədlər və hesabatlar kimi digər konfiqurasiya obyektlərini əlavə etməkdir. Məsələn, “Soraqçalar” (Справочники) budağı altında yeni bir soraqça (məsələn, “Müştərilər”) yaratdıqda, “Əsas” vərəqəsindəki “Ad” sahəsini doldurduqdan sonra, “Alt Sistemlər” (Подсистемы) vərəqəsinə keçərək yaratdığımız “İdarəetmə” alt sisteminin qarşısındakı qutuya işarə qoyuruq. Bu, “Müştərilər” soraqçasının “İdarəetmə” alt sisteminin menyusunda görünməsini təmin edəcək. Eyni prinsip digər konfiqurasiya obyektləri üçün də tətbiq olunur. “Daxilolma” sənədləri “Daxilolma” alt sisteminə, “Satış” sənədləri isə “Satış” alt sisteminə daxil edilə bilər.

Alt Sistemlərin Vizual Təkmilləşdirilməsi

İstifadəçi interfeysini daha cəlbedici və informativ etmək üçün alt sistemlərə xüsusi ikonalar əlavə etmək mümkündür.

  1. Alt Sistemin Redaktə Pəncərəsini Açmaq: Konfiqurator rejimində “Alt Sistemlər” budağı altında redaktə etmək istədiyiniz alt sistemin üzərində iki dəfə klikləyin (məsələn, “İdarəetmə”).
  2. İkona Seçmək: Açılan pəncərədə “İkona” (Картинка) sahəsinin yanında üç nöqtəli düyməyə (“…”) klikləyin. Bu, ikona seçimi pəncərəsini açacaq.
  3. İkona Əlavə Etmək: Siz ya 1C:Müəssisənin standart ikona kitabxanasından uyğun bir ikona seçə bilərsiniz, ya da öz kompüterinizdən xüsusi bir şəkil yükləyə bilərsiniz. Seçimi etdikdən sonra “OK” düyməsinə klikləyin.

Bu vizual təkmilləşdirmələr tətbiqin ümumi görünüşünü xeyli yaxşılaşdırır və istifadəçilərə müxtəlif bölmələr arasında daha asan fərq qoymağa kömək edir. Məsələn, “İdarəetmə” üçün idarəetmə ilə əlaqəli bir ikona, “Daxilolma” üçün giriş oxu simvolu, “Satış” üçün isə pul və ya səbət simvolu istifadə oluna bilər.

Şərh yaz

Sizin e-poçt ünvanınız dərc edilməyəcəkdir. Gərəkli sahələr * ilə işarələnmişdir